Mediterranean Gratinated Eggplants, Crispy and Quick, They Disappear Before They Cool Down.
  • Difficulty: Very easy
  • Cost: Very economical
  • Preparation time: 5 Minutes
  • Portions: 4
  • Cooking methods: Air Frying, Electric Oven
  • Cuisine: Italian
  • Seasonality: All seasons

Ingredients for the Gratinated Eggplants

  • 2 eggplants
  • 8 sun-dried tomatoes
  • 4 tablespoons breadcrumbs
  • 1 oz oz grated parmesan cheese
  • to taste fine salt
  • 2 tablespoons extra virgin olive oil
  • 1 tablespoon chopped parsley

Tools

  • 1 Air Fryer
  • 1 Knife
  • 1 Cutting board
  • Parchment paper
  • 1 Bowl

Steps for Preparing the Gratinated Eggplants

To prepare the delicious air fryer eggplants with breadcrumbs and parmesan, start by choosing fresh, firm, medium-large eggplants.

Wash them thoroughly under running water, remove the ends, and cut into cubes on a cutting board, about two centimeters, leaving the skin on.

In a bowl, pour the breadcrumbs, grated parmesan, fine salt, and extra virgin olive oil, and mix; the mixture should be moist.

Place the eggplants in the air fryer, without overcrowding, I recommend making 2 batches, and pour over the mix, mixing by hand so they are well breaded.

Cook at 392°F for 15-18 minutes, turning halfway through cooking, they should become golden and crispy.

You can also cook in a static oven, place the cubes on a tray with parchment paper and pour over the breadcrumb and parmesan mix, and mix. Bake at 374°F for 20-25 minutes, turning halfway through cooking. In a convection oven at 392°F for 15-18 minutes.

  • After cooking, add the sun-dried tomatoes cut into pieces and the chopped parsley.

Storage

Let them cool completely.

Store them in an airtight container or cover the tray with plastic wrap/foil and keep in the refrigerator for 2 days

Reheat in Convection Oven: 356°F for 8-10 minutes, preferably with grill function in the last 2 minutes.

Air Fryer: 338°F for 5–6 minutes.

In Freezer Allow the cooked eggplants to cool.
Divide into portions and place in containers or freezer bags.
Heat them directly from frozen
